EAPG Early American Pattern Glass (Early American Pressed Glass) glass cruet in the No. 325 Opal Swirl pattern in an opalescent white. Ground and polished pontiled base. Produced by Hobbs Glass Co. Circa 1888 to 1891. Missing the stopper. The cruet has some haze to the interior and is missing the stopper, but otherwise good condition. Measures approximately 3 3/8 inches wide x 5 1/8 inches tall. We can offer packaging and shipping on this lot to a domestic USA address for $30.
